Pakistan's busiest airport is reopening today, after a five-hour assault ended early this morning.

Gunmen disguised as police guards stormed the international terminal of Jinnah International Airport in Karachi, setting off explosions.

They also waged a fire fight against security forces, leaving 29 dead, including all 10 of the attackers. A number of security forces and airline officials were also killed.

The Pakistani Taliban have claimed responsibility for the attack, vowing to carry out more.
